Abstract
An antenna device includes an antenna element and a radio wave characteristic switching controller. The antenna element is fitted on a vehicle. The antenna element transmits and receives a radio wave. The radio wave characteristic switching controller changes, in case of an interruption of communication via the antenna element, a characteristic of the radio wave to be transmitted and received by the antenna element, until restoration of communication.
